Subject: Re: Mintty 2.2.2: possible hang when breaking (CTRL+C) out of pinging unresponsive host

On 25/11/2015 08:06, Thomas Wolff wrote:
> Am 24.11.2015 um 23:29 schrieb Marco Atzeri:
>>

>> ...
>> I assume it is an interaction with mintty.
> Many problems of that kind attributed to mintty are actually problems
> with cygwin or especially pty.
> Please test also with another terminal (xterm, rxvt, ...).
> Also some more details could be helpful as I cannot reproduce the issue
> (output of `type ping`, actual host pinged).
> ------
> Thomas

you are right is not a mintty only issue.
Same happens in xterm


$ which ping
/usr/bin/ping

$ ping 2.2.2.2
PING 2.2.2.2 (2.2.2.2): 56 data bytes

It sticks here forever, CTRL+C ineffective.
Process Explorer or Task Manager are needed to kill the process.
Also kill -9 PID is ineffective

On the old cygwin.bat (aka windows cmd)
CTRL+C is effective

  64 $ ping 2.2.2.2
PING 2.2.2.2 (2.2.2.2): 56 data bytes

----2.2.2.2 PING Statistics----
2 packets transmitted, 0 packets received, 100.0% packet loss
